Project

General

Profile

Bug #11398

Warning about zip dependency is at top of installation of plugin

Added by Nicolas CHARLES 3 months ago. Updated about 1 month ago.

Status:
Released
Priority:
N/A
Category:
Packaging
Target version:
Target version (plugin):
Severity:
Trivial - no functional impact | cosmetic
User visibility:
Operational - other Techniques | Technique editor | Rudder settings
Effort required:
Very Small
Priority:
45

Description

When we install the plugin, the output is

This package depends on the following
  on rpm : zip
  on dpkg : zip
It is up to you to make sure those dependencies are installed
[master a7dd6ec] Installing rudder-agent-dsc source in configuration-repository
 65 files changed, 3823 insertions(+)
 create mode 100644 dsc/dsc-common/logging.ps1
 create mode 100644 dsc/dsc-common/rudder-directives.st
 create mode 100644 dsc/dsc-common/rudder-system-directives.st
 create mode 100644 dsc/dsc-common/template/nxlog.conf
 create mode 100644 dsc/initial-policy.psm1
 create mode 100644 dsc/ncf/10_ncf_internals/classes.ps1
 create mode 100644 dsc/ncf/10_ncf_internals/convertPSObjectToHashtable.ps1
 create mode 100644 dsc/ncf/10_ncf_internals/ncf_lib.ps1
 create mode 100644 dsc/ncf/10_ncf_internals/states.ps1
 create mode 100644 dsc/ncf/30_generic_methods/_check_compliance.ps1
 create mode 100644 dsc/ncf/30_generic_methods/_rudder_common_report.ps1
 create mode 100644 dsc/ncf/30_generic_methods/command_execution.ps1
 create mode 100644 dsc/ncf/30_generic_methods/directory_absent.ps1
 create mode 100644 dsc/ncf/30_generic_methods/directory_create.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_copy_from_local_source.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_create.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_download.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_enforce_content.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_from_shared_folder.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_from_template.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_from_template_mustache.ps1
 create mode 100644 dsc/ncf/30_generic_methods/file_remove.ps1
 create mode 100644 dsc/ncf/30_generic_methods/registry_entry_absent.ps1
 create mode 100644 dsc/ncf/30_generic_methods/registry_entry_present.ps1
 create mode 100644 dsc/ncf/30_generic_methods/registry_key_absent.ps1
 create mode 100644 dsc/ncf/30_generic_methods/registry_key_present.ps1
 create mode 100644 dsc/ncf/30_generic_methods/service_ensure_disabled_at_boot.ps1
 create mode 100644 dsc/ncf/30_generic_methods/service_ensure_running.ps1
 create mode 100644 dsc/ncf/30_generic_methods/service_ensure_started_at_boot.ps1
 create mode 100644 dsc/ncf/30_generic_methods/service_ensure_stopped.ps1
 create mode 100644 dsc/ncf/30_generic_methods/service_restart.ps1
 create mode 100644 dsc/ncf/30_generic_methods/service_status.ps1
 create mode 100644 dsc/ncf/30_generic_methods/user_absent.ps1
 create mode 100644 dsc/ncf/30_generic_methods/user_password_clear.ps1
 create mode 100644 dsc/ncf/30_generic_methods/user_present.ps1
 create mode 100644 dsc/ncf/30_generic_methods/user_status.ps1
 create mode 100644 dsc/ncf/30_generic_methods/variable_dict.ps1
 create mode 100644 dsc/ncf/30_generic_methods/variable_dict_from_file.ps1
 create mode 100644 dsc/ncf/30_generic_methods/variable_dict_merge.ps1
 create mode 100644 dsc/ncf/30_generic_methods/variable_string.ps1
 create mode 100644 dsc/ncf/30_generic_methods/variable_string_from_file.ps1
 create mode 100644 dsc/ncf/30_generic_methods/windows_component_absent.ps1
 create mode 100644 dsc/ncf/30_generic_methods/windows_component_present.ps1
 create mode 100644 dsc/policy.psm1
 create mode 100644 dsc/resources/environment.ps1
 create mode 100644 dsc/resources/inventory.ps1
 create mode 100644 dsc/resources/update.ps1
 create mode 100644 dsc/rudder.ps1
 create mode 100644 ncf/30_generic_methods/registry_entry_absent.cf
 create mode 100644 ncf/30_generic_methods/registry_entry_present.cf
 create mode 100644 ncf/30_generic_methods/registry_key_absent.cf
 create mode 100644 ncf/30_generic_methods/registry_key_present.cf
 create mode 100644 ncf/30_generic_methods/service_status.cf
 create mode 100644 ncf/30_generic_methods/user_password_clear.cf
 create mode 100644 ncf/30_generic_methods/user_status.cf
 create mode 100644 ncf/30_generic_methods/windows_component_absent.cf
 create mode 100644 ncf/30_generic_methods/windows_component_present.cf
 create mode 100755 ncf/ncf-hooks.d/post.write_technique.51_dscify.sh
 create mode 100644 techniques/system/dsc-common/1.0/logging.ps1
 create mode 100644 techniques/system/dsc-common/1.0/metadata.xml
 create mode 100644 techniques/system/dsc-common/1.0/rudder-directives.st
 create mode 100644 techniques/system/dsc-common/1.0/rudder-system-directives.st
 create mode 100644 techniques/system/dsc-common/1.0/template/nxlog.conf
 create mode 100644 techniques/systemSettings/misc/registryManagement/3.0/metadata.xml
 create mode 100644 techniques/systemSettings/misc/registryManagement/3.0/registry_edition.ps1.st
Converting existing techniques to support dsc ...INFO: Alternative source path added: /var/rudder/configuration-repository/ncf
[master 8871db9] Converting existing techniques to dsc
Done
Committing techniques folder...[master c4dc54a] Updating techniques after DSC plugin upgrade
Done
ok: reload techniques from files.
[]
Restarting jetty
 $ service rudder-jetty restart
Stopping Jetty: OK
Setting umask to 0007
Starting Jetty: . . . OK Wed Sep 20 08:30:28 UTC 2017

so the warning about zip is totally lost :/
It should appear at bottom

Associated revisions

Revision 7d284a43
Added by Alexis MOUSSET 2 months ago

Fixes #11398: Warning about zip dependency is at top of installation of plugin

History

#1 Updated by François ARMAND 3 months ago

  • Severity set to Trivial - no functional impact | cosmetic
  • User visibility set to Operational - other Techniques | Technique editor | Rudder settings
  • Effort required set to Very Small
  • Priority changed from 0 to 46

Very insightfull remark :)

#2 Updated by Alexis MOUSSET 2 months ago

  • Project changed from Rudder Windows Agent to Rudder
  • Category changed from Packaging to Packaging
  • Target version set to 4.1.8

Moving to Rudder as is should be fixed in rudder-pkg

#3 Updated by Alexis MOUSSET 2 months ago

  • Status changed from New to In progress
  • Assignee set to Alexis MOUSSET

#4 Updated by Alexis MOUSSET 2 months ago

  • Status changed from In progress to Pending technical review
  • Assignee changed from Alexis MOUSSET to Benoît PECCATTE
  • Pull Request set to https://github.com/Normation/rudder-packages/pull/1392

#5 Updated by Alexis MOUSSET 2 months ago

  • Status changed from Pending technical review to Pending release

#6 Updated by Vincent MEMBRÉ about 1 month ago

  • Status changed from Pending release to Released
  • Priority changed from 46 to 45

This bug has been fixed in Rudder 4.1.8 and 4.2.1 which were released today.

Also available in: Atom PDF